**Pros and Cons of Buying Specialties DS-190571 Fine-Thread Socket-Head Bolts (5/16-24, Knurled)**

**Pros:**

1. **Precision Fit and Strength** Fine-thread bolts (5/16-24) offer better clamping force and load distribution compared to coarse threads, reducing the risk of loosening or stripping. This is particularly useful in applications requiring tight tolerances or high stress, such as automotive, machinery, or structural assemblies.

2. **Knurled Design** The knurled head provides a secure grip for hand tightening, reducing the need for tools in certain applications. This can be advantageous in field repairs, maintenance, or situations where quick assembly is required without additional hardware.

3. **Durability and Corrosion Resistance** These bolts are likely made from high-quality steel (possibly alloy or stainless) with a protective coating (e.g., zinc, black oxide, or chromate), which enhances resistance to corrosion and wear. This extends the bolt s lifespan in harsh environments.

4. **Compatibility with Socket Tools** The socket-head design allows for easy installation and removal using a socket wrench, making them ideal for applications where frequent disassembly is needed (e.g., engine components, transmissions, or industrial equipment).

5. **Standardized Sizing** The 5/16-inch shank diameter and 24 threads per inch are common measurements, ensuring availability of washers, nuts, or replacement bolts if needed. This reduces the risk of sourcing difficulties.

6. **Versatility** Fine-thread bolts are suitable for a wide range of applications, including automotive suspension, engine mounts, hydraulic systems, and general machinery, making them a practical choice for DIYers or professionals.

7. **Brand Reliability** Specialties Manufacturing is a reputable supplier known for producing high-quality fasteners. Their products often meet or exceed industry standards, ensuring reliability and performance.

**Cons:**

1. **Cost** Fine-thread bolts, especially from a trusted brand like Specialties, may be more expensive than generic or coarse-thread alternatives. This could be a drawback for budget-conscious projects or bulk purchases where cost efficiency is critical.

2. **Potential Overkill for Light-Duty Use** If the application does not require fine threads (e.g., non-critical structural connections or decorative work), these bolts may be unnecessarily robust, leading to wasted material or higher costs without added benefit.

3. **Tool Dependency** While the knurled head is helpful, it may not provide enough grip for very tight or stubborn bolts, requiring a socket wrench. This could be inconvenient in situations where tools are not readily available.

4. **Limited Availability of Coatings** Depending on the specific model, the coating (e.g., zinc plating) may not be suitable for extreme environments (e.g., high heat, chemical exposure, or marine applications). Additional treatments (e.g., cadmium plating or stainless steel) might be needed for specialized use.

5. **Thread Stripping Risk** Fine threads are more prone to stripping if overtightened or if the mating part (e.g., nut or tapped hole) is not properly aligned or has damaged threads. This requires careful installation to avoid failure.

6. **Stocking Requirements** Since these are specialty bolts, they may not be readily available in every hardware store. Purchasing online or from a distributor could involve shipping delays or higher costs for small quantities.

7. **Potential for Misuse** If not used correctly (e.g., overtightening, improper lubrication, or mixing with incompatible materials), these bolts may fail prematurely or cause damage to surrounding components.
